JPMorgan Global Emerg Mkts (LON:JEMI) Sets New 1-Year High – Here’s Why

JPMorgan Global Emerg Mkts Inc (LON:JEMIGet Free Report) shares reached a new 52-week high during mid-day trading on Wednesday . The company traded as high as GBX 208 and last traded at GBX 207, with a volume of 143888 shares. The stock had previously closed at GBX 203.

JPMorgan Global Emerg Mkts Stock Up 1.4%

The company has a market cap of £538.63 million, a PE ratio of 4.74 and a beta of 1.08. The business’s fifty day moving average is GBX 189.51 and its 200-day moving average is GBX 182.12.

JPMorgan Global Emerg Mkts (LON:JEMIG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, April 2nd. The company reported GBX 2.20 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ter. JPMorgan Global Emerg Mkts had a net margin of 94.77% and a return on equity of 24.31%. The company had revenue of GBX 745 million for the quarter.

Take a closer look at emerging markets

JPMorgan Emerging Markets Dividend Income plc provides a diversified income-oriented way to tap into the growth potential of global emerging markets.

Key points:

Expertise – Extensive network of country and sector specialists from one of the longest established emerging market teams in the industry.
Portfolio – Focused on finding sustainable businesses that have good dividend growth prospects.
Results – Provides a lower risk way to access emerging markets, by investing in stable companies with regular income and good governance structures.

Why invest in this trust

The trust primarily seeks a dividend yield which is higher than the average emerging market company but also growth companies in this exciting equity sector.
